Personally, I love Halloween - for a number of reasons. It drives me nuts to hear about Christians who turn the light off, or go out for the evening... or attend their church&#039;s &quot;Fall Festival.&quot; The one night of the year where your whole community is out on the street mingling - going to each other&#039;s houses and admiring each other&#039;s little one&#039;s costumes... talk about a ministry! 
The practice of our Halloween customs is really a Christian invention. The whole idea behind dressing up like little goblins, ghosts and devils is that we&#039;re making fun of Satan - he&#039;s been defeated. All that is supposed to be scary and evil is mocked by little children in costumes with baskets full of candy. Certainly our culture has lost a lot of this Christian background - just like Easter and Christmas - but that doesn&#039;t mean we should just give up and leave it to the world. Let&#039;s take it back! Celebrate Halloween better than everyone else - have the best costumes, the best candy and the best decorations! Be the house that all the kids want to come to... and please, DO NOT PASS OUT TRACTS INSTEAD OF CANDY! You&#039;re asking for an egging. 
Everyday is a day that God created for His glory - not everyday except for Halloween.
